NY: Warner Books, 1988. Book. Near Fine. Hardcover. Inscribed by Author(s). 1st Edition. Ashe wrote a piece for the New York Times (November 13, 1988) that ended with this paragraph: Proportionately, the black athlete has been more successful than any other group in any other endeavor in American life. And he and she did it despite legal and social discrimination that would have dampened the ardor of most participants. The relative domination of blacks in American sports will continue into the foreseeable future. Enough momentum has been attained to insure maximum sacrifice for athletic glory. Now is the time for our esteemed sports historians to take another hard look at our early athletic life, and revise what is at present an incomplete version of what really took place..
